要问阿里云服务器怎么架构,简直就像是在厨房里炒菜——得有调料、有锅、有火候,少了哪样都不香。今天咱们就用最通俗易懂的方式,带你扒一扒阿里云的架构套路,让你随手一布置,性能爆表,省心又省钱。
**众所周知的架构原则:高可用、弹性伸缩、安全可靠**,这是阿里云的三大金刚。搞明白这三个点,你就像拿到了配方,可以干饭啦。
### 1. 分层设计:拆分天赋技能一点都不难
架构设计要“拆分层次”——越清晰越好,别搞得跟糊涂卷一样,混乱是性能的天敌。
- **前端层(Web层)**:就是用户“脸面”所在,直接面对用户请求。这里可以用ECS实例或ALB(应用负载均衡)做“面子工程”,保证用户体验丝滑如丝绸。
- **应用层(业务逻辑层)**:就是我们打仗的兵团,比如存放你的应用服务、爬取数据的小兵。可以用ECS实例部署你的微服务,配合容器化技术如Docker或Kubernetes增加弹性。
- **数据存储层**:数据库、缓存,这里是保障数据安全和快速响应的关键。阿里云提供MySQL、Redis等多种托管服务,既强大又省心。
- **安全层**:别忘了,安全是“必备队长”。配置VPC(虚拟私有云)、安全组、WAF(Web应用防火墙)等,像给你的云打上一层“隐形护城河”。
### 2. 弹性伸缩,像猴子一样灵活
你要的不是死板的架构,而是可以应对“人潮汹涌”和“偏僻荒凉”两极的弹性。阿里云的弹性伸缩(Auto Scaling)就像会变魔术的变形金刚,需求多了,它膨胀;需求少了,它收缩,不浪费资源。
设置好弹性策略,比如设置最大实例数和最小实例数,当访问量“蹭蹭”冲高时,后台自动“涨粉”到多台ECS实例;流量降温,又能“将军”们有序退场。
### 3. 负载均衡器,保证“门面光鲜”
别忘了,“吃饭前要打个头阵”。阿里云的SLB(服务器负载均衡)就能帮你把请求分散到多个后端实例,避免单点宕机,把“脸面”维护得无懈可击。
### 4. 数据存储,稳如老铁
数据层次要明确,分布式数据库、多地容灾、备份快照、冷热分离……这些都是你“护宝”的绝技。MySQL自带多种高可用方案,Redis提供高效缓存,你也可以用阿里云的ApsaraDB托管数据库,省得自己“琢磨”。
### 5. 安全架构,护体神盾
安全架构不止“贴个防火墙”,还得考虑VPC(虚拟私有云)、专线、SSL证书、权限管理等。战场上,内外部防护一手抓,确保数据传输安全。
### 6. 监控和运维,像个老司机
别只顾建了个“把戏”,还得“监控”到天黑地老。阿里云有云监控(CloudMonitor),可以帮你实时掌握Cpu、流量、响应时间的变化趋势。出问题了,能一眼看出端倪。
还有,应用配置自动化管理工具(如Terraform或Ansible)让你的“云上肠粉”不粘锅,无忧出行。
### 7. 网络架构合理布局
网络架构决定了整体“快不快”。阿里云VPC让你玩出“私有云”范,好比自己在家建房子,门牌、院墙都自己定。合理分配子网,配置弹性公网IP、VPN,确保流量畅通无阻。
**最后,千万别忘了——实名制、权限严格、备份多地灾备,都是“硬核”保障。**
如果你想搭个“爆款”网站,要考虑前端与后端的关系,数据如何高速同步,安全怎么保障,遇见突发状况怎么备战……当然啦,若你觉得这个“云端建筑”太复杂,还是想休闲一下,玩游戏赚零花钱就上七评赏金榜,网站地址:bbs.77.ink。
总之,阿里云的架构就像是一场“大胃王”比赛,吃得越巧,赢得越快。把握好层次分明、弹性伸缩、安全稳固这几把利器,任你在云端遨游,像个“云中仙”。